Chelich ( bosn. and Horv. Čelić , Serb. Cheliћ ) is a city in the north-eastern part of Bosnia and Herzegovina , the administrative center of the homonymous community of the Tuzlan canton of the Federation of Bosnia and Herzegovina . Located on the hilly and gentle slopes of the Maevitsa ridge on the Tuzla - Brcko highway.
